Abstract

A new modular, digital, distributed feedback control system has been developed and installed to control the TCV plasma. With many more inputs and outputs, it provides the possibility to build control algorithms using far more information on the plasma state than previously possible as well as the ability to control many more actuators, including the multi-megawatt, multi-launcher electron cyclotron heating and current drive system. This paper provides an overview of the new control system, its integration into the TCV systems and its successful application to control the TCV plasma discharge. © 2010 IEEE.
